Came in for Sunday Brunch around 1130. Ordered Enchiladas Rancheros, Country Fried Steak and the Tomato Melt with Pepper Jacks Grits and a Biscuit.

Absolutely slammed packed and the Waiter/Kitchen did a great job keeping up. Coffee Bar has a ton of different selections and it’s actually pretty cool.

Main dishes were great but the sides were average. Delicious Sausage Gravy on the Country Fried Steak. Would be great on Biscuits and Gravy because the Biscuit was rather dry. The Home Fries lacked flavor and the Pepper Jack Grits had to be doctored up for taste. Tomato Melt had a ton of the Scallion Cream Cheese and was delicious. Enchiladas Rancheros was probably the best overall dish. Highly recommend the upgrade to Chorizo.

Prices were average for the area. Would return and would recommend for a good breakfast/brunch. No pics as I forgot my phone.
